Icefall course in Cogne - All levels

5 days of ice climbing in Cogne

This Icefall course is also suitable for people who want discover the Cascade de Glace only to those who already have a little experience in this unusual activity since they will be able toAnd climb to the top of the rope in order to gradually become autonomous. Chamonix is a very suitable site for The Icefall since it offers a wide variety of fields that will allow you to acquire very rich gestures.In case of bad weather in France or if you wish, we can carry out this course of Icefall in Italy in Val de Cogne, about 1 hour from Chamonix. This site is also superb, offering a large number of ice waterfalls of all levels.

OUR +: All our guides are very good teachers. They will be eager to make you progress individually During this Chamonix Ice Fall.

We'll see during this Icefall week How:

  • Evolve in an ice cascade up to grades IV+ to V.
  • Dry-tooling* climb fairly easy sections (M3 to M4),
  • Ensuring a second and a first of cordée,
  • Carry out a safe reminder
  • Create reliable relays,
  • Perform an abalakov (ice lunula, allowing you to abseil down waterfalls).

Icefall course in Cogne - All levels: Program day by day

Discover the complete course of your internship day by day. Each stage is designed for your technical progress and safety in the mountains with an experienced guide.

Course length : 5 days

Day 1

Icefall: Right side: 220m, grade 4+ to 5 > Cogne

Black chevron bottom icon - Navigation Mountain Guide Adventure

Meet at 7:15am in Chamonix with all the equipment and departure in the direction of Valnontey, above the village of Cogne and at the foot of Grand Paradis. After an hour and 20 minutes of approach we will arrive at the foot of this beautiful 5-length ice waterfall “Patrie de Droite”, offering passages at 90° over 10m. Night in a cottage in Cogne.

Day 2

Lillaz gully: 220m, grade 4 in ice and M4+ (M = mixed climbing, ice and rock) > Cogne

Black chevron bottom icon - Navigation Mountain Guide Adventure

For this 2nd day of internship, we will go to the right bank of Valeille. It will take us 1 hour 15 minutes to reach the foot of this chute. It is a superb varied itinerary with a beautiful atmosphere and a breathtaking view of Mont-Blanc. Night in a cottage.

Day 3

Ice fall: Tuborg: 220m, grade 5 > Cogne

Black chevron bottom icon - Navigation Mountain Guide Adventure

This time we will go to the left bank of Valeille. A short approach of 40 minutes will take us to the start of this beautiful waterfall of 5 lengths. It starts with a 50m wall at 85°. Higher up, you can try climbing in the lead, in 75° lengths. Night at the cottage.

Day 4

Icefall: Il Candelabro de Coyote: 180m, grade 4+/5 > Cogne

Black chevron bottom icon - Navigation Mountain Guide Adventure

Today we head back to the left bank of Valeille. After 40 minutes we will be at the foot of this waterfall. On the program 2 very beautiful ice cigars, with passages from 10m to 90°. The arms will get hot. Night at the cottage

Day 5

Icefall: Super repentance: 220m, grade 6 > Valnontey

Black chevron bottom icon - Navigation Mountain Guide Adventure

To finish this course in Cogne in style, we will carry out “Super Repentance” on the right bank of Valnontey. This magnificent ice fall is a reference grade 6. The most difficult length is a superb 30m column at 90°. Return to Chamonix and review of the ice climbing course at the end of the day.
